Thevenins theorem thevenins theorem states that a linear twoterminal circuit can be replaced by an equivalent circuit consisting of a voltage source v th in series with a resistor r th where v th is the open circuit voltage at the terminals and r th is the input or equivalent resistance at the terminals when the independent sources. Thevenins theorem states that for the purpose of determining the current in a resistor, r l connected across two terminals of a network which contains sources of emf and resistors, the network can be replaced by a single source of emf e th and a series resistor r th, to find the current passing through the load r l. In circuit theory, thevenins theorem for linear electrical networks states that any combination of voltage sources, current sources, and resistors with two terminals is electrically equivalent to a single voltage source v in series with a single series resistor r.
